The U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) defines a penny stock as any security issued by a small public company priced at less than $5 per share. Though the term “penny” suggests that these stocks trade for less than $1, which was historically the case, the current definition is broader. When trading penny stocks, beginners often think they are getting "more for their money" because they can buy more shares in total. This is a myth. Stocks that trade for pennies are far more risky because they trade OTC and do not meet the strict financial requirements to be listed on a major stock exchange like the NASDAQ or NYSE.

The key distinction is that "pink sheets" refers to how a stock is traded (over-the-counter). "Penny stocks" refers to the share price of a given company (less than $5 per share). While most penny ...

A penny stock listed on a major exchange can experience a price plummet after being delisted. Brokers often impose purchase minimums on penny stocks.
